Drillers Bounce Buccs In AFL Quarterfinal

Monday, July 30, 2012 - 12:52 PM
By Jeff Henson
Grande Prairie

The Grande Prairie Drillers' new look running game was a huge success in their 44-34 AFL Quarterfinal win over the Central Alberta Buccaneers.

All five Drillers touchdowns were scored on the ground. Drillers quarterback Nathan Aldred says the two fullback package of Brendan Urness and Cam White was introduced because the club was missing several key receivers on Saturday night.

"[Guys like] Simon Pfau. It's been a struggle not having Brent Fulmek this year as well so we've kinda had to adapt to that. We established a running game so our passing game opened up underneath."  


Next up in the semi finals, which will see the Drillers visit the Calgary Wolfpack on August 11th.
